Cities endorse the Mannheim Message

The Mannheim Message, a collective response by cities to the European Green Deal, was finalised by European Mayors on 21 September 2020 and was formally presented to the European Commission on 1 October 2020 as part of the 9th European Conference on Sustainable Cities & Towns, organised by ICLEI Europe and the City of Mannheim (Germany). It builds on and bolsters the transformative actions catalysed by the Basque Declaration (2016).

Further, it calls for local authorities to be key partners in the development of Local Green Deals and the European Green Deal, to be used as key tools to facilitate this transformation.

In order to successfully develop and implement local Green deals, public procurement plays a significant role to drive innovation and market transformation and to reach societal and environmental goals

The development of the Mannheim message was  led by ICLEI - Local Governments for Sustainability and the City of Mannheim, with support from the Committee of the Regions and input from Mayors from across Europe.
